## Deploying the Gatewick Proctor Queue

Deploys are pretty painless: push to main, wait for the pipeline, then watch the queue drain dashboard for five minutes. If candidates pile up mid-exam, roll back first and ask questions later — the queue replays safely. Everything the workers care about lives in one config block, shown here for reference.

settings of bafof-yagef:
JOROX_PIN=8740
JOROX_TENANT=pelox
JOROX_METRICS_HOST=metrics.jorox.qorvelworks.internal
JOROX_SEAL=seal_c78f63c1
JOROX_STANDBY_TEAM=norax

Welcome to the team. Since the v9 upgrade of the Corvette query planner in our Danbrook analytics cluster, several join-heavy queries regressed badly. To reproduce, you need read access to the Planview telemetry service, but the credential we previously documented expired last Friday and will return a 401. Please replace the value in your local profile under the planview section, then rerun the regression harness. The current working key is included directly below.

app token of bahaf-tajeg = zpat23_SjjsllwiLmXbtS65veZaV47

### Checklist Item 22 — Barcode Scanner Integration

Confirm the Tallygate scanner bridge validates payload length and checksum before forwarding scans to the inventory API, and that the service account used by the bridge holds write access only to the intake queue. Verify firmware update channels are restricted to signed packages. Sign-off for this control is provided by the individual named below.

account owner for bawip-tahag: Raleth Quenok